Definition of Steel Frames with Tensile Stiffness
A steel frame with tensile stiffness refers to a structural system that utilizes steel beams and columns to support the weight of the building and resist external forces such as wind, earthquake, and snow loads. The term "tensile stiffness" emphasizes the ability of the steel members to resist tensile stresses, which are forces that tend to stretch or pull apart. This characteristic makes steel frames highly resistant to bending and torsion, making them ideal for use in tall buildings and other structures that require high levels of structural integrity and stability.
